Apple Health - extremely long delay between step updates

Over the past couple of weeks, I've noticed that the Health app will now only refresh the steps counter every 10-12 minutes or so. Disappointing enough, but not disastrous. However, since yesterday's upgrade to iOS 18.0.1, the delays have become much, much worse: over two hours, then another three hours after that. This is plainly absurd.


What's going on? Is this the way it is with the new upgrade, in a push for more battery life?? Is it now designed to update only if movement is detected? If I've been out for a hike or a run, and lay the phone down, it's as though the clock freezes at that time, and will only update once it senses more steps.


Even more infuriating, when it does eventually refresh, the update is already 12 minutes out of date: right now my phone clock tells me it's 16:16, but the steps 'update', seconds ago, says 16:04...??


This has, for me, rendered the app utterly useless. Any assistance (or suggestions for another step-counting app) will be appreciated.

iPhone 12, iOS 18
